String sql="select * from offerpoolride
WHERE date >= '1997-05-05'";
我是初學者,任何人都可以請幫助我如何檢索這些?我無法在Sql中檢索大於或等於特定日期的日期。
String sql="select * from offerpoolride
WHERE date >= '1997-05-05'";
我是初學者,任何人都可以請幫助我如何檢索這些?我無法在Sql中檢索大於或等於特定日期的日期。
use backtick for date
SELECT * FROM `offerpoolride` WHERE `date` >= '1997-05-05';
我不是100%地肯定ANSI-SQL,但是在T-SQL你可以使用下列內容:
SELECT * FROM TABLE WHERE [date] >= '19970505'
所以日期格式 'YYYYMMDD' 輸入。我假設你的領域被稱爲日期...
你應該日期
String sql="select * from offerpoolride WHERE date(my_date) >= date '1997-05-05'";
應該做你的工作進行比較日期。
你有什麼錯誤? – 2015-03-03 05:29:04
你有什麼錯誤? – Backtrack 2015-03-03 05:29:08